key:  Vo3  =  loud  Vo2  =  medium  loud  Vo1  =  quiet  Operation  with  mains  adapter  This  device  can  also  be  used  with  a  

mains  adapter.  In  this  case,  there  must  be  no  batteries  in  the  compartment.  The  power  supply  is  available  under  order  

number  071.60  in  a  specialist  shop  or  at  a  customer  service  address.  •  The  blood  pressure  monitor  may  only  be  used  

with  the  power  supply  described  here  to  prevent  possible  damage  to  the  device.  •  Plug  the  power  supply  into  the  appropriate  socket  

on  the  right  side  of  the  blood  pressure  monitor.  The  mains  adapter  may  only  be  connected  to  the  mains  voltage  specified  on  the  type  plate.  •  Then  connect  the  mains  plug  to  the  

socket.  •  After  using  the  blood  pressure  monitor,  first  unplug  the  power  supply  from  the  outlet  and  then  from  the  blood  pressure  monitor.

C)  Now  wrap  the  free  end  of  the  cuff  around  the  arm,  but  not  too  tightly,  and  close  the  Velcro.  The  cuff  should  be  attached  so  tightly  that  you  can  still  push  two  fingers  under  the  cuff.
